News Fashion Critic Will Pen Biography of Elaine Stritch Alexandra Jacobs, a fashion critic and feature writer for the New York Times, will pen a biography of Tony and Emmy Award winner Elaine Stritch, who passed away July 17, 2014, at age 89.

Jacobs' proposal for the biography sold in an auction to Farrar, Straus & Giroux, according to capitalNewYork.com. The publishing deal is reportedly for $251,000-$499,000.

"I think I'm the only person in New York who not only never met Elaine Stritch, but never saw her perform live," Jacobs stated. "I'm frantically spinning that as an advantage because I feel like most people who interacted with her had a very strong reaction to her ... Since I never met her in the flesh, I lack any bias."

Broadway favorite Stritch was last on The Great White Way in the critically acclaimed revival of Stephen Sondheim's A Little Night Music.
